SOURCE: 89 toyota pickup torque specs. for flywheel and
Thoroughly clean the flywheel bolts. Coat the first 3 or 4 threads of each bolt with sealant. Install the flywheel, aligning the previously made marks. Install the bolts finger-tight.
Tighten the bolts in a crisscross pattern and in several passes to the correct tightness:
Since you have the flywheel off, be sure and inspect the rear main seal. Now might be a good time to replace it. Be sure the rear flange of the flywheel is clean before re-install.
Be sure to inspect or, better yet, replace the bronze pilot bushing. I f you don't know how to get it out leave a comment. J
